2016-04-14 16 views
1

如果我有一個矩陣和一行,如何確定矩陣中有多少行?確定矩陣中的行數

例如,如果我得到了矩陣[[1,2,3],[4,5,6],[7,8,9]],並且我得到了行[4,5,6],那麼我想知道它是第二行a.k.a. board[1]

(這只是一個小例子,但它應該在更大的矩陣進行檢查)

回答

2

如果你有矩陣(名單列表):

board = [ 
    [1, 2, 3], 
    [4, 5, 6], 
    [7, 8, 9], 
] 

你可以得到它的位置通過使用.index()

>>> board.index([4, 5, 6]) 
1 
+0

Wooow,這真的很簡單......謝謝! –

+0

@ruben_pants不客氣。由於您在這裏看起來很新,請閱讀[當某人回答我的問題時該怎麼辦?](http://stackoverflow.com/help/someone-answers) – cpburnz